Medical-Legal Partnerships: MidPenn currently operates three Forensic Partnerships (MLPs) in its service area. MLPs combine legal defense with health care to address environmental and social factors that impact a patient`s health. In Lancaster County, MidPenn works with Care Connections at Lancaster General Hospital and Tabor Community Services. In Dauphin County, an Interest on Lawyer Trust account funds MidPenn`s partnership with Hamilton Health Center. In Berks County, a grant from Be Well Berks funds MidPenn`s partnership with Reading Hospital. Legal Intervention for Victims and Empowerment: Through MidPenn`s Legal Intervention for Victims and Empowerment (LIVE) project, they are able to offer survivors of domestic and sexual violence additional legal representation in protection orders, family law, housing, and eviction. Currently, the LIVE project operates in Berks, Blair, Clearfield, Cumberland, Franklin, Fulton, Huntingdon, Lancaster, Lebanon, Schuylkill and York County.

In Franklin, Fulton, Lancaster and York counties, specialized services are available for seniors who are victims of abuse and financial exploitation. Sometimes the bureaucracy doesn`t want to listen, especially when it makes a mistake. A grandmother with limited income was informed that she had received an overpayment of $1,100 in her Social Security benefits and was ordered to pay it back. At that time, the woman was struggling to pay for a new roof and stove for the old house where she cared for her granddaughter. One of our legal aid membership programs, North Penn Legal Services, has appealed on his behalf. In the end, it was decided that the overpayment was Social Security`s fault, and the claim for reimbursement was withdrawn. Without legal assistance, the woman would have been unjustly punished. MidPenn Legal Services is a 501c(3) nonprofit law firm that receives funding to provide free civil law services to low-income residents and survivors of domestic violence and sexual assault in 18 counties in central Pennsylvania.

MidPenn lawyers and paralegals handle cases involving domestic violence, housing law, utilities, suppression, support services, consumer law, family law, tax controversies, and seniors` rights. Low Income Taxpayer Clinic: MidPenn`s Low Income Taxpayer Clinic (LITC) provides legal advice and representation to low-income taxpayers and taxpayers who speak English as a second language in disputes with the Internal Revenue Service. Cases include: innocent spouse relief, injured spouse claims, audits, deficiency notices, earned income tax credit appeals, identity theft, privileges and duties, and contractual disputes between employees and self-employed individuals. LITC also manages tax education programs for Latin American social services and outreach organizations. Call 1-844-MPLS-TAX (844-675-7829) to contact LITC. Labor Rights Project: MidPenn`s Labor Rights Project helps individuals overcome barriers to employment, obtain unemployment benefits, preserve their existing jobs, and clean up criminal records through deletions, file sealings, and pardons so they can find employment.
